i have a basic lexmark printer. i recently used an ink refill kit for the black cartridge and it worked great. the problem is the printer stops the print jobs because it say the cartridge is empty even though its full. is there anyway to reset the printer so it will let me print

Not sure if lexmark printers behave the same way as HP. I believe that with HP you need to change cartridges or the printer will not accept the refill as a "NEW" cartridge. You therefore need two cartridges to use alternately between refills. ( I do not know this for certain as I've never used a refill personally)

my epson printer has a chip in all the cartridges preventing me from just refilling cartriges. in order for my printer to recognize it as a full cartridge i have the option to either buy new chips, (Cheap but time consuming) or a chip reseter (Expensive and not worth it). i havent tried either, im out of ink for the last 3 months.... but maybe thats what your printer does...
